|
本帖最后由 13330863440 于 2019-3-28 14:16 编辑
刚入手一个刷了高恪的 新路由3。发现固件功能很强大。
单线多拨也拨号成功。就在一切都OK时发现虽然拨号拨了多个。但是阿里云的动态域名只能配置一个。纠结了很久都没找到解决办法。
问题:http://www.gocloud.cn/bbs/forum.php?mod=viewthread&tid=11780&page=1#pid200758
最后自己写了个程序来实现。
程序是java程序。需要java环境才能运行,建议使用JAVA8,更低版本没有试过。JAVA配置参考:JAVA环境配置
一个是程序文件。
一个是配置文件:config.json- //注释信息不能写在结尾,只能单行存在。
- //改配置使用json格式,请保证格式正确,若修改配置请重启程序,请勿添加或就该注释信息,否则可能会报错。
- {
- //路由器地址---http://地址或域名:端口
- "gocloud_router_host": "你的路由器地址",
- //路由器登陆用户名
- "gocloud_router_user": "路由器登录名",
- //路由器登陆密码
- "gocloud_router_password": "路由器登陆密码",
- //检测更新时间(秒)
- "utime":300,
- //域名解析配置
- "domain_config":[
- {
- //兼容多个阿里云账号,所以每一个都配置ID和Secret
- //阿里云配置:https://usercenter.console.aliyun.com/#/manage/ak
- "AccessKey_ID":"AccessKey_ID",
- "Access_Key_Secret":"Access_Key_Secret",
- //主域名,例如: test.github.com 则填: github.com
- "domain":"主域名",
- //子域名,例如: test.github.com, 则填: test
- "child_domain":"子域名",
- //路由器接口名称,在路由器管理界面-网络设置-接口概览。可以找到(使用小写)
- "interfaceAddress":"wan"
- },
- {
- "AccessKey_ID":"AccessKey_ID",
- "Access_Key_Secret":"Access_Key_Secret",
- "domain":"主域名",
- "child_domain":"子域名",
- "interfaceAddress":"wan1"
- }
- ]
- }
复制代码
执行方式: 先配置好JAVA环境变量。然后将压缩包解压。修改配置文件。
cmd命令行切换到 到当前目录: java -jar gocloud_aliyun_domain.jar
下载地址:
链接:https://pan.baidu.com/s/19EEt4oRMJzKGfDPAz061BA 提取码:ps6w
|
|